Hi team — as you start the rotation, please familiarize yourselves with the Larkspur retention sweeper. It runs nightly at 02:00 and purges records past their retention class; customer confusion about "missing" exports usually traces back to it. Before filing a bug, check the sweeper's run log and exclusion list, both documented here.

dashboard of yaguf-hahig = https://grafana.urlaqworks.test/secrets

Management Meeting Minutes — Kestrel Goods Co.

Attendees: department heads. Quick session on the inventory write-down for the Lumera accessory line. Finance confirmed the charge lands this quarter; warehouse will clear stock by month-end. Nobody loved it, but the numbers were clear. Action: heads to brief their teams after the announcement. Context for next steps appears below.

board note of bagaf-haduf: The renewal with Druathek Holdings closes at $10 million a year, 5 percent below the last contract. Project Zorath slips by six weeks because of the staffing delay.

Handover for Fixturewren, our test-data factory lib. Plugin authors: traits resolve lazily, so don't mutate registries after boot. Sequence counters reset per suite unless pinned. The sandbox runner enforces strict isolation; violations fail the build, not just warn. Keep plugin manifests minimal. The runner reads these settings at startup, reproduced here for reference.

deployment values, yadug-bawif:
[framir]
team = pelox
access_code = ac_a38ab2
owner = tamion.julael
host = framir.tolvaqlabs.test
port = 11211
peer = tammir.zemvargrid.local
salt = 2215ef03
pin = 1541